Tax Lawyers in Seekonk

To pay for basic services like police, schools, firefighters, libraries, and hospitals, the government of Seekonk, Massachusetts collects taxes.

In Seekonk, Massachusetts, there are many different sources of tax revenue. Irrespective of the source, however, taxes are always levied in amounts determined by the relevant laws. Typically, taxes are calculated as a percentage of something, such as income or home value. Sometimes, however, they are simply collected as a flat fee (usually in exchange for a license or permit).

Residents of Seekonk are legally required to pay their taxes. Failure to do so can result in civil penalties, criminal fines, and even imprisonment.

Sources of Tax Dollars in Seekonk, Massachusetts

A wide variety of activities are subject to taxation in Seekonk, Massachusetts, creating a considerable range of revenue sources. For example, cities typically impose a sales tax, charge fees for certain licenses, and collect tolls on roads and bridges.

Sales Tax: The sales tax imposed by Seekonk is on top of the sales tax collected by the government of . Sales taxes are typically fairly small - about 5-7% at the state level, plus a city sales tax that's typically one percent or less.

Licensing Fees: The city of Seekonk may require business owners to acquire a license from the local government before they begin operating within city limits. Typically, the main hurdle involved in obtaining one of these licenses is paying a fee to the city government. Although these payments are called "fees" as opposed to "taxes," they operate in the same way, and serve largely the same purpose, as taxes.

Bridge/Road Tolls: Most large cities in the U.S. charge fees, or tolls, on automobiles entering the city via public bridges and highways. This money is, more or less, a tax on everyone who drives into Seekonk via public infrastructure. This means that everyone who visits is required to make at least a small contribution to the government services they'll be using while there.
